Abstract : This paper presents an information-driven online video composition system. The system has several advantages: users are encouraged to assist video composition; available video cameras and a video switcher are managed based on both signal characteristics and users~{!/~} suggestions; the system can automate the video composition process based on compositions it experienced in the past. The problem formulation of online video composition approach is consistent with many well-known empirical approaches widely used in previous systems and may provide analytical explanations to these approaches. We demonstrate the use of this approach with field data.
